While Apache itself has limited specialized options, residents typically look to nearby cities like Lawton or Oklahoma City for BMW-certified technicians. It's crucial to seek shops with specific European automotive training and proper diagnostic tools for BMW's complex systems.
Given Oklahoma's hot summers and dusty conditions, common local issues include cooling system failures (thermostats, water pumps) and clogged cabin air filters. BMWs are also prone to oil leaks from valve cover gaskets and oil filter housings, which should be addressed promptly.
BMW repair costs are typically 20-40% higher than domestic car repairs due to specialized parts, required software, and technician expertise. Sourcing parts to rural Apache may add slight delays or shipping costs, so getting estimates from shops in Lawton is advisable for budgeting.
For routine maintenance (oil changes, brakes) you can use a qualified local independent shop, but for complex computer diagnostics, recalls, or advanced drivetrain issues, the nearest BMW dealerships in Oklahoma City or Fort Worth are recommended.
